The first Sunday of November the parish of Gosford gathered in wonderful weather on the International celebration of parish life. This community building time began with a family Mass and was followed by a food fair.
70 parishioners of St Patrick’s Parish, Gosford leading by Salvatorian Collaborators group enjoyed an alfresco lunch followed by a moving, sometimes tearful, always noisy (not much) film "The Sapphires". It was held at the Avoca Beach Theatre, the Alders cinema on the central coast. A group of parishioners supplied the lunch (very good lunch).
At the beginning of September our community in Australia gathered on Regional Chapter to reflect on the past in order to look forward into the future. Theme of our Chapter was taken from the Year of Grace “Starting afresh from Christ”.
Before our formal meeting sessions we welcomed Archbishop Timothy Costelloe SDB who in reflections before our chapter shared with us few thoughts on religious life and introduced the theme of the Year of Grace.
During these last few days of June 2012, members of the Australian Region of the Polish Province met at "St John of God" retreat centre in Safety Bay, Western Australia (Archdiocese of Perth) for the annual Salvatorians’ retreat led by Fr. Roman Slupek SDS, Lecturer of Catholic Apologetics in the Salvatorian Seminary in Bagno, Poland. The topic of our spiritual exercises is the theme of the XVIII General Chapter of the Salvatorians to be held this October in Krakow: "To know, to love and to proclaim".
On Wednesday night Fr Stan Bendkowski SDS celebrated his Silver Jubilee Mass with our community followed by social gathering. It was a wonderful opportunity to express thanks to God for the gift of Fr Stan's priesthood and his ministry in our Salvatorian community. It was also a good time of prayer for the vocations to priesthood and religious life. Congratulations Fr Stan.
Fr Lawrence Murphy SDS (member of the British Pro-Province of the Salvatorians) joined our community on Tuesday evening to celebrate his 50 years of priesthood as Salvatorian. He presided our evening Mass and joined us on dinner and social gathering. Fr Lawrence was one of the first Salvatorians in Australia.
Mass and launching of the Vision and Mission Statement of the Salvatorian Collaborators on Friday April 13, 2012
Close to one hundred Collaborators from New South Wales and Western Australia met at the Salvatorian Community House Currambine, for a special Mass of the launching of the Salvatorian Collaborators Vision and Mission Statement.
On the Saturday 24th of March 22 Salvatorian Collaborators from Gosford, Pymble and Pittwater (NSW) held a Reflection Day at Somersby lead by Fr Robert. The topic was Fr Francis Jordan's experience of the Cross based on his Spiritual Diary and his Exhortations and Admonitions.
